The chief minister Siddaramaiah-led Karnataka government has decided to make Kannada mandatory from Class 1 from academic year 2018-19. The rule will be applied to all schools in Karnataka, including private, linguistic minority, and Central board schools. Udupi, Dec 30: A high school student who went to play into the sea at Malpe beach in Udupi district, drowned, when he was carried by waves on Friday. The deceased has been identified as Manjunath A.K., a student of class 9 from Halivan village in Davangere district.
